I bought 2 pygmy date palms from home depot and my yard man told me they would not survive the winter here in SC----why were they sold at home depot if the winlters are too cold-they've been planted and were VERY heavy so to remove and take back would be a big process


Image
Answer from NGA
March 23, 2009
Pygmy date palms are hardy to about 28F degrees. If they are planted in protected areas where buildings will keep cold winds from blasting them, they will be fine. If your landscape regularly suffers from frost damage, Pygmy date palms may not be a good choice. So, the bottom line is that they will grow in your area, providing they are given protection from prolonged freezing temperatures.
